Updating CDH using parcels

I installed a cluster (several slaves, one master and a separate admin wih CM) using Cloudera manager 4.5 without parcels (CDH 4.2) few months ago and it's working well.

I updated Cloudera Manager to 4.8 and it's working again.

But now I want to update CDH on all my hosts to CDH 4.5 using parcels : the step one (downloading) is ok, the distribution on all hosts is ok, the uncompress is ok (step 2) is ok on the servers, but Cloudera Manager interface doesn't "see" that all the parcel is uncompress.
And then I can't click on the step 3 (activation)

Here the answer of the status page : http://clouderamanager:7180/cmf/parcel/details

[{"cluster":{"id":1,"name":"Cluster 1 - CDH4","urls":{"downloadUrl":"/cmf/parcel/downloadUpstream","deleteUrl":"/cmf/parcel/deleteLocal","activateUrl":"/cmf/clusters/1/activateParcel","deactivateUrl":"/cmf/clusters/1/deactivateParcel","restartPopupUrl":"/cmf/clusters/1/parcelRestartPopup","distributeUrl":"/cmf/clusters/1/distributeParcels","undistributeUrl":"/cmf/clusters/1/undistributeParcels","cancelUrl":"/cmf/clusters/1/cancelParcel","upgradeUrl":"/cmf/clusters/1/upgradePopup"}},"states":[{"version":"1.2.3-1.p0.97","product":"IMPALA","isUpgradeNeeded":false,"releaseNotes":null,"state":{"description":"0/1 parcels disponibles.","errors":[],"progress":0,"count":0,"warnings":[],"stage":"AVAILABLE_REMOTELY","totalProgress":0,"totalCount":0,"combinedProgress":0,"combinedTotalProgress":100,"hostCount":0,"roleCount":0,"serviceCount":0}},{"version":"1.1.0-1.cdh4.3.0.p0.21","product":"SOLR","isUpgradeNeeded":false,"releaseNotes":null,"state":{"description":"0/1 parcels disponibles.","errors":[],"progress":0,"count":0,"warnings":[],"stage":"AVAILABLE_REMOTELY","totalProgress":0,"totalCount":0,"combinedProgress":0,"combinedTotalProgress":100,"hostCount":0,"roleCount":0,"serviceCount":0}},{"version":"4.5.0-1.cdh4.5.0.p0.30","product":"CDH","isUpgradeNeeded":false,"releaseNotes":null,"state":{"description":"100 % distribués et 0 % décompressés.","errors":[],"progress":6050,"count":0,"warnings":[],"stage":"DISTRIBUTING","totalProgress":12100,"totalCount":11,"combinedProgress":50,"combinedTotalProgress":100,"hostCount":0,"roleCount":0,"serviceCount":0}}]}]


{"description":"100 % distribués et 0 % décompressés."

100 % distributed and 0 % uncompressed but all the data is uncompressed on servers in

root@bigdatas09g:/opt/cloudera/parcels/CDH-4.5.0-1.cdh4.5.0.p0.30# ll
total 28
drwxr-xr-x  7 root         root         4096 Nov 21 02:55 ./
drwxrwxrwx  3 cloudera-scm cloudera-scm 4096 Jan  9 15:23 ../
drwxr-xr-x  2 root         root         4096 Nov 21 02:55 bin/
drwxr-xr-x 19 root         root         4096 Nov 21 01:04 etc/
drwxr-xr-x 22 root         root         4096 Nov 21 03:18 lib/
drwxr-xr-x  2 root         root         4096 Nov 21 02:55 meta/
drwxr-xr-x  7 root         root         4096 Nov 21 01:05 share/

I have also an integration server where all the rôle are installed and it's working well.

Do you have and idea to solve my problem ?

Can I "force" Cloudera manager to tell it that the uncompress is done ?

Thanks for you help



Just to solve this topic, many days after.


The problem came from cloudera manager agents which was blocked on slaves.


After to have restarted all the servers, and specially all the agents, I succeded to activate the parcels and it's working well now.


But sometimes, for some update, the agent are blocking and it's impossible to restart the master : I have to kill cloudera-scm-agent and cloudera-scm-agent-db.



